Results, order, filter

RELX INC Careers Business Development Manager - Tolley Learning Jobs

  • Business Development Manager - Tolley Learning

    RELX INC - Farringdon, United Kingdom
    ... services via personal presentations and clearly written proposals Building long-term profitable ... cross-functionally to develop sales and marketing strategies to promote LN’s product and services ...